AC-17
Extension card 2 - AI1 measured voltage 1
Address:
44049
Min.:
0.000
Unit:
V
Max.: 12.000 Data type: UInt16
Default:
2.000
Change:
At once
Value Range:
0.000 V to 12.000 V
Description
When analog voltage correction is conducted on AI1, a correction curve is obtained based on two
points, each of which corresponds to a measured voltage and a displayed voltage. The measured
voltage is the voltage measured using a meter, and the displayed voltage is the AI1 voltage before
correction (U4-12).
